charged with altering the forged and altered promissory note, to wit an L. O. U., in the name of one, Lall Singh, knowing the same to be forged and altered.

Prisoner pleaded not guilty, Mr. G. N. Orme, Crown Solicitor, prosecuted, and Mr.

F. C. Jakin defended.·
